Abstract
The purpose of this paper is to introduce the Full-Body Image segmentation tool, FBIseg, for Visible Human Project and similar projects around the world. Currently, full body image segmentation is typically performed manually with different level of computer assistance. It is laborious and prohibitive. The FBIseg developed by our group combines the state-or-the-art machine segmentation capability with human expert knowledge to attain efficiency and accuracy in full-body segmentation. The FBIseg tool was written in the Java programming language for its portability. Key features in the FBIseg tool include the use of multiple segmentation techniques on a dataset (e.g. CT scan of a single subject) and the switching of segmentation algorithms from one slice image to another for optimizing segmentation efficiency and accuracy.
